簡體   English   中英

Flutter 在為 iOS 構建時卡在“正在運行 Xcode 構建...”

[英]Flutter gets stuck on "Running Xcode build... " when building for iOS

我有一個現有的 Flutter 項目,已經運行兩年了。 但是現在突然之間,當我嘗試在 iOS 上構建或運行它時,它總是卡在Running Xcode build...上。

flutter build ios --debug
Running "flutter pub get" in MyApp...                           0.6s
Building org.example.myapp for device (ios)...
Automatically signing iOS for device deployment using specified development team in Xcode project: 36U5A9XK2Z
Running pod install...                                              1.6s
Running Xcode build...                                                  
(This is taking an unexpectedly long time.)       ⣻

之前這只需要 1-2 分鍾,現在我已經嘗試等待長達 2 小時,所以顯然有些地方不對勁。 其他現有應用程序構建得很好。

我試過“通常的嫌疑人”:

  • flutter clean
  • 刪除~/Library/Developer/XCode/DerivedData
  • 重新啟動計算機。
  • 刪除podfile.lock並再次運行pod install
  • 刪除了一些“困難”的插件(即所有與 Firebase 相關的插件和所有基於 Swift 的插件)。

似乎沒有任何幫助。 如果我嘗試從 XCode 或 IntelliJ 中運行應用程序,也會發生同樣的事情。 版本信息如下。

Flutter 1.22.5 • channel stable • https://github.com/flutter/flutter.git
Framework • revision 7891006299 (7 weeks ago) • 2020-12-10 11:54:40 -0800
Engine • revision ae90085a84
Tools • Dart 2.10.4```

XCode 11.1
OSx 10.15.1

您可以嘗試刪除項目中的ios文件夾,然后通過運行flutter create --platforms=ios [PROJECT_PATH]再次生成 iOS 構建。 那應該從您的 Flutter 代碼生成一個 iOS 項目。 之后,您可以嘗試再次運行flutter build ios

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M